What is the difference between Provider Success Manager vs Customer Success Manager?

AspectProvider Success ManagerCustomer Success Manager
Primary FocusSupporting healthcare providers or vendors to optimize service deliveryEnsuring customer satisfaction and retention across various industries
Work EnvironmentHealthcare, technology, or SaaS companies working with providersBroad industries including SaaS, retail, finance, and more
Required CredentialsRelevant industry certifications, healthcare or technical background often preferredCustomer service or success certifications, general business background
Employer UsageHealthcare organizations, SaaS companies serving providersTech companies, SaaS providers, and diverse industries

The Provider Success Manager primarily focuses on supporting healthcare providers or vendors to optimize their use of services or products, often requiring industry-specific knowledge. In contrast, the Customer Success Manager works across various industries to ensure overall customer satisfaction and retention. While both roles emphasize client support and relationship management, their target audiences and industry contexts differ.

Job description

Hi, we're Oscar. We're hiring an Associate to join our Provider Success team.

Oscar is the first health insurance company built around a full stack technology platform and a relentless focus on serving our members. We started Oscar in 2012 to create the kind of health insurance company we would want for ourselves-one that behaves like a doctor in the family.

About the role:

The Associate, Provider Success drives solutions to acute and systemic issues within Oscar's operations. The Associate owns end-to-end solutioning of provider escalations, orchestrating efforts cross-functionally with multiple internal partners, while building strong relationships through effectiveness and trust.

You will report into the Manager, Provider Success.

Work Location: This position is based in our Tempe, Arizona office, requiring a hybrid work schedule with 3 days of in-office work per week. Thursdays are a required in-office day for team meetings and events, while your other two office days are flexible to suit your schedule. #LI-Hybrid

Pay Transparency: The base pay for this role is: $87,188 - $114,434 per year. You are also eligible for employee benefits, participation in Oscar's unlimited vacation program and annual performance bonuses.

Responsibilities:

  • Leads and cross collaborates on problem definition, acute error remediation, and root cause solution development
  • Utilizes data to drive business decisions to impact cross-functional strategy
  • Develops trusting relationships with relevant internal/external stakeholders through effective communication, collaboration and positive outcomes.
  • Supports Oscar team members through knowledge sharing, process documentation, and tooling development
  • Other duties as assigned
  • Compliance with all applicable laws and regulations

Requirements:

  • 3+ years of relevant technical experience in operations, data analysis, and/or consulting within healthcare
  • 3+ years experience cooperatively developing project plans with internal and external stakeholders
  • 3+ years experience designing and improving workflows, including development of accompanying operating and technical procedures and tooling
  • Experience managing complicated business challenges: developing understanding, distilling and communicating that understanding to techn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Healthcare experience

Bonus points:

  • Knowledge management, training, or content development in operational settings
  • 2+ years experience using SQL to manipulate and analyze large data sets to solve business problems
  • Process Improvement or Lean Six Sigma certification
  • Structured, systematic, and critical thinking
  • Strong verbal and written communications
